Braised Pork Belly with Noodles contains 1017 calories per serving (51% of a 2,000 kcal daily diet), with 68g fat, 56g carbs, and 42g protein. This nutrition data is based on real meals tracked by Arise app users.
| Ingredient | Amount | kcal | Fat | Carb | Protein |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Braised Pork Belly | 200 g | 700 | 60 | 10 | 30 |
| Egg Noodles | 150 g | 225 | 3 | 40 | 8 |
| Braised Sauce | 30 ml | 60 | 3 | 6 | 1 |
| Scrambled Egg | 20 g | 30 | 2 | 0 | 3 |
| Spring Onion | 5 g | 2 |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Macronutrients (Fat, Carbs, Protein) are shown in grams (g).
